Types of Metallurgical Testing and Equipment

1. Spectrometer for Stainless Steel

Spectrometers are critical for analyzing the elemental composition of stainless steel and other alloys. These instruments provide precise readings of the chemical makeup, helping in the selection of materials for specific applications.

2. Metallurgical Analysis of Metallic Materials

This analysis focuses on understanding the microstructure and mechanical properties of metals. Techniques such as microscopy and hardness testing are employed to evaluate strength, ductility, and resistance to wear.

3. Metallurgical Polishing Machine

Polishing machines are used to prepare metal samples for microscopic examination. By achieving a smooth, reflective surface, these machines allow for detailed observation of the microstructure and detection of imperfections.

4. Metallurgical Lab Equipment

A comprehensive metallurgical lab includes a range of equipment, such as microscopes, hardness testers, and furnaces, each contributing to different aspects of testing and analysis.

6. Metallurgical Accounting

Metallurgical accounting involves tracking and analyzing the flow of metals through production processes. This practice is essential for optimizing efficiency, reducing waste, and ensuring accurate reporting.

FAQ: 

1. What is the purpose of metallurgical testing?

Metallurgical testing ensures that metallic materials meet specified standards for quality, performance, and safety.

2. How does a spectrometer work for metal analysis?

Spectrometers analyze the elemental composition of metals by measuring the emitted light spectrum, providing precise chemical data.
